4. Meanwhile, the President Spends All Day at Inauguration

A chief usher coordinates move-in day, giving the White House staff floor plans and photos that show where each items goes (these are logistical issues the president elect discusses with the chief usher beforehand), according to Slate. “During the move-in process, the first family is at the inauguration or watching the parade,” says Blakeman. “By the time the parade is over, they have the inaugural balls, so they’re out of the residence for a long time, allowing all of this work to take place.”
